Why IT, automotive, and machine learning companies are coming together to achieve fully autonomous driving
Intel, BMW, Mobileye, and others to collaborate until 2021
Building an open platform for next-generation automotive, from vehicles to data centers.
Intel, BMW Group, and Mobileye are joining forces to develop self-driving cars and make future mobility concepts a reality.
These three companies, leaders in the automotive, computer vision and technology, and machine learning industries, have joined forces to develop solutions that will enable commercialization of highly autonomous driving by 2021.
The future of automated driving promises to significantly improve our lives and society. However, the path to a fully autonomous world is complex and requires end-to-end solutions that integrate intelligence across the entire network, from vehicle door locks to data centers. Transportation service providers of the future must effectively leverage rapidly evolving technologies, collaborate with entirely new partners, and be prepared for disruptive innovation opportunities.

Intel, BMW, and Mobileye will jointly develop the solutions and innovative systems needed to commercialize fully autonomous driving by 2021. The BMW iNEXT model will be the cornerstone of the BMW Group's autonomous driving strategy and lay the foundation for fully autonomous vehicle operation, enabling autonomous driving on highways as well as automated ride-sharing solutions in urban environments.
The three companies believe that automated driving technology will make travel safer and easier. The goal of this collaboration is to develop future-ready solutions that not only eliminate the need for drivers to take their hands off the steering wheel, but also move beyond Level 3 (eyes off) to the ultimate level (mind off) where they don't need to think about driving at all, freeing them to use their driving time for leisure or work. This level of autonomy will technically enable the final step (Level 5) of driverless vehicles. This opens the door to autonomous driving by 2021 and lays the foundation for entirely new business models in a connected, mobile world.
These three companies gathered at BMW Group headquarters in Munich, Germany, on the 1st to pledge to actively pursue industry standardization and define an open platform for autonomous driving. The joint platform will address Level 3 to Level 5 autonomous driving challenges and will be available to various automakers and other industries that can benefit from autonomous devices and deep machine learning.
The three companies have already agreed on a set of deliverables and milestones to deliver a fully autonomous vehicle based on a common reference architecture. In the near future, the three companies plan to demonstrate autonomous driving testing with a highly automated driving (HAD) prototype. Furthermore, in 2017, the platform will be expanded to operate multiple autonomous vehicles based on scalable autonomous driving testing.
Intel offers a comprehensive portfolio of technologies needed to power and connect hundreds of millions of smart, connected devices, including automobiles. Intel will deliver powerful computing performance that scales from Intel® Atom™ to Intel® Xeon™ processors, up to a total of 100 teraflops (trillion operations per second) of power-efficient performance without the need to rewrite code, to handle the complex workloads required by autonomous vehicles in urban environments.
Through its Strategy Number One > Next, the BMW Group has developed its own framework to continue to lead the way in premium individual mobility. This approach will be realized in 2021 with the BMW iNEXT model, marking a new chapter in mobility, the company said.
